Today

Dry, bright and mild or even rather warm for some today, Thursday, with long spells of hazy sunshine, once early mist and fog patches clear. Highest temperatures 13 to 18 degrees, best values across the Midlands and West. Light to moderate southeast winds, occasionally fresh in Munster.

Tonight

Dry with clear spells to begin tonight. Cloud will gradually build from the south, bringing showers or perhaps longer spells of rain to southern parts of Munster and Leinster at first, then spreading elsewhere towards dawn. Milder than recent nights with temperatures no lower than 7 to 10 degrees in moderate to fresh southeasterly winds decreasing light to moderate by morning.

Tomorrow

Mostly cloudy tomorrow, Friday, with scattered showers, the showers merging to give longer spells of rain at times. A few heavy or thundery downpours are possible, especially in the south and west. Highest temperatures of 11 to 16 degrees in light to moderate east to southeast breezes.
